Comment on “Nonperturbative finite T broadening of the ρ meson and dilepton emission in heavy-ion collisions”

In this Comment we point out several problems concerning kinematical singularities which are encountered in the calculation of the dilepton rates by Ruppert and Renk [Phys. Rev. C 71, 064903 (2005)]. We also comment on the method introduced by van Hees and Knoll [Nucl. Phys. A683, 369 (2000)] and further used by Ruppert and Renk [Phys. Rev. C 71, 064903 (2005)], Renk and Ruppert (arXiv:hep-ph/0603110, arXiv:hep-ph/0605130), and Riek and Knoll [Nucl. Phys. A740, 287 (2004)].
